Description:
10-(2-Oxopropyl)phenoxatellurin-10-ium, with the CAS number 7224-68-2, is a chemical compound that belongs to the class of organotellurium compounds. It features a tellurium atom bonded to a phenoxy group and a 2-oxopropyl substituent, which contributes to its unique properties. Organotellurium compounds are known for their diverse applications in organic synthesis, catalysis, and as intermediates in the production of pharmaceuticals. The presence of the tellurium atom imparts distinctive reactivity, often involving redox processes. This compound may exhibit interesting electronic properties due to the heavy tellurium atom, which can influence its behavior in chemical reactions. Additionally, the oxopropyl group may enhance its solubility and reactivity in various solvents. As with many organometallic compounds, safety precautions should be taken when handling this substance, as it may pose health risks or environmental hazards. Overall, 10-(2-oxopropyl)phenoxatellurin-10-ium represents a fascinating area of study within the field of organometallic chemistry.
Formula:C15H13O2Te
InChI:InChI=1/C15H13O2Te/c1-11(16)10-18-14-8-4-2-6-12(14)17-13-7-3-5-9-15(13)18/h2-9H,10H2,1H3/q+1
SMILES:CC(=O)C[Te]1c2ccccc2Oc2ccccc12
